Lakhanpahari in context

With 1,427 people at the 2011 Census, Lakhanpahari was the 263rd most populous of its district's 2302 villages, above the district average of 543.

Literacy stood at 78.17%, 23.2 points above the district's rural average of 55.01%.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 1027, 104 above the rural national 923.
